Planned the weekend getaway for my bf’s birthday in this town, sooooo happy to find this amazing restaurant for his big day. The atmosphere was upscale but very family friendly. Service was great even though it was very busy on a Saturday night. The server tried her best to check with us if everything went OK, I saw her kept running back and forth to the kitchen, and I’m sure the kitchen was super busy as well. Food: they have a great selection of appetizers and we seriously wanted to try all of them, we ordered tonight’s special: salmon tartar. Escargot, seared scallops, foie gras & fried calamari. Salmon tartar: love the sauce, very refreshing and it matched with the salmon so well, it comes with the crispy toasts, it gave the crunchiness from the soft salmon texture. Escargot: it wrapped inside the puff, I personally think it’s too much of the puff or not enough escargot inside. I barely tasted the escargot, I would prefer the traditional escargot dish just with garlic butter. Seared scallops: top notch! Perfectly cooked and seasoned, well done dish! Must have! Foie gras: OMG, full of favors, a lot of favors in a bite that melt in your mouth. Another Must have! Fried calamari : I love they have fried zucchini and jalapeños in it to balance out the texture from the calamari . Main entrees we had risotto, monk fish and chicken masala. Great portion. All main were a bit too salty for us, but still tasted good and we enjoyed them. All of the dishes had great presentation which I enjoyed them and think it’s important. I reserved the table online and wrote down it’s for my bf birthday celebration, they did not forget and bring out the panna cotta at the end with a candle and birthday song. Thank you for the wonderful dinner experience.

Ruth and I were looking for a good place for dinner in or around East Stroudsburg Pennsylvania. We discovered there were a few. Some had good service, standard fair and nominal pricing. It has been rare to find all 3 of these qualities in a single restaurant. They always have something lacking. We decided that if we wanted better we'd have to be more particular and perhaps demanding and definitely pay more. So after a steakhouse or two we stumbled upon MOMENTO. From the moment we entered the staff were attentive to our needs. The menu was ambitious to say the least. The cocktail menu showed imagination. The wine menu was mesmerizing . And then, then there was the menu. Chef Nicola Mersini presents the best of his world to his clientele. He believes we deserve it. He does not disappoint. We chose the 6 Course Captains Tasting and the traditional wine pairing. Our server, Alaina, prepared us for this culinary adventure. We had our cocktails and then she presented the first of many fine wines. Each a different wine for each plated tasting, each tasting brought from the kitchen to our table by Chef Nicola with descriptions of the ingredients, there preparation and there significances. We spent about 2 hours being served and sated. From the amuse bouche to dessert and after dinner drinks. I am 73 years old and have never been served such delicious food or been so enthusiastically well treated and honored by an establishment. These were people who believed in what they were doing and happy to show us their best. They made us believers also and I hope East Stroudsburg feels as proud of this establishment as the staff of MOMENTO does. Now I will admit the experience was pricey…..but I was never disappointed at any point of service, hospitality or gastronomical creativity and originality. I would go back again tomorrow. I will declare this visit to this restaurant, this Chef, these servers and wait staff a milepost in my life that will be the standard of fine dining...

From start to finish, our evening at Momento was nothing short of fantastic. My friend and I both ordered the trout special, which was perfectly prepared—fresh, flavorful, and plated with true attention to detail. Our wives chose the beef short rib paired with pasta, and I have to say, it was one of the most impressive dishes we’ve seen in quite some time. The richness of the short rib balanced beautifully with the pasta, creating a true yin and yang of taste and presentation. Each dish not only looked like a work of art but tasted every bit as good as it appeared. The service elevated the experience even further. Kylea took exceptional care of us—warm, attentive, and professional without being overbearing. She anticipated what we needed before we had to ask, made thoughtful recommendations, and ensured everything flowed seamlessly throughout the evening. In fact, if I could, I would hire her in a second—she embodies everything you could want in hospitality. To complement the meal, we enjoyed two bottles of excellent wine. The selection paired beautifully with our entrees, and again, Kylea’s guidance helped us make the perfect choice. For a fine dining experience of this caliber, we were pleasantly surprised at how fair the pricing was. The quality of the food, the atmosphere, and the outstanding service all combined to deliver incredible value. Even the smallest touches set Momento apart. When we requested a little food to go, it wasn’t just bagged and dropped at the end of the table—it was carefully placed on its own stand. That kind of unmatched attention to detail shows the pride and care this team brings to every part of the experience. Momento is a gem. It’s rare to find a place where the food, service, and atmosphere come together so perfectly, but they’ve truly mastered it. We left not only full and happy but already talking about when we’ll be back. A five-star experience...

So I had a party of 8 for my birthday. We came specifically for the pasta at your table on Wed. We left very very disappointed 😞

First let me say I've been going to momentos for 20 years, ever since they were in their old location where pizza one is now. I always liked their pizza and dishes that are pizzeria standards, like chicken francaise or penne vodka etc.

Then they moved to the old Ned's on Ninth location, and things sort of changed. They started separating their two menus and was trying to do an upscale restaurant and keep their pizzeria going as well.

I know chef Nicola is said to be an accomplished chef. The website says he has trained all over the world, been on TV etc.

And here we are, a table of 8, spending no less then $40 a person at his restaurant and he doesn't even say hello when he pulls the cart up to the table to make the pasta!!!!! Doesn't introduce himself, doesn't ask even who's birthday might be????

This is how you treat your customers???

Ok, so he's not personable, I can get over that. Then he makes the pasta, adds boiled chicken, yes I kid you not, it was not grilled chicken, it was not sliced in a nice presentation..it was two pieces of boiled chicken with what seemed liked a slimy coating on it.

He should be ashamed of himself to let something like that out to a customers plate at a restaurant with a chef of his caliber. He put it on the plate, so he cant blame his staff...I bet his worst helper in the kitchen would know better.

We will never go there again unfortunately. I'm not sure chef Nicola would even care, because he didn't seen to care about us when we were customers...why care if we never come back.
